Dear, I haven't told you
the many times I've wished
to capture the stars above

to have something in my hands
that twinkle more than your eyes do

For I was blinded,
and I wanted to forget.

To forget how you lit up every
piece inside of me
and left with an agonizing
heat that started a fire in my lungs

I tried to breathe you out
but your entirety has consumed
whatever monsters I had.

Now, you’ve replaced all of them – the monsters.
